请教DataGrid中不能删除数据问题(100分)

  • 主题发起人 主题发起人 codecb
  • 开始时间 开始时间
C

codecb

Unregistered / Unconfirmed
GUEST, unregistred user!
提示说:
应用程序中的服务器错误。
--------------------------------------------------------------------------------
无法从指定的数据表中删除。
说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。
异常详细信息: System.Data.OleDb.OleDbException: 无法从指定的数据表中删除。
代码:
private void newsGrid_DeleteCommand(object source, System.Web.UI.WebControls.DataGridCommandEventArgs e)
{
string MyConnString="Provider=Microsoft.Jet.OLEDB.4.0;Data Source="
+Server.MapPath(".")+"..//database//db.mdb;";
myconn.ConnectionString=MyConnString;
string strcomm="delete from NewsTable where NewsID="+e.Item.Cells[1].Text;
OleDbCommand mycomm=new OleDbCommand(strcomm,myconn);
myconn.Open();
mycomm.ExecuteNonQuery();//运行时候出错
myconn.Close();
BindData();
}
 

Similar threads

S
回复
0
查看
3K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
2K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
928
SUNSTONE的Delphi笔记
S
回复
2
查看
411
极品铁观音
后退
顶部